Azerbaijan

Azerbaijan is a country on the Western coastline of the Caspian Sea and North of Iran. In recent years it has developed its energy resources and is a leading exporter of oil and gas. Its key seaport is its capital Baku which has developed into a regional trade hub between Asia and Europe.
